Why These Are the Top Pest Control Contractors in Saint Cloud

The pest control market serving Saint Cloud, Wisconsin, is characterized by high-quality regional providers rather than a high density of local, in-town companies. Due to Saint Cloud's rural setting and proximity to lakes and forests, common pest issues include rodents (mice, voles), ants, spiders, and wildlife (raccoons, squirrels). Termite pressure is moderate, and bed bug services are in demand. The competition level is moderate but service quality is generally high, as the dominant companies are established, professional organizations with strong reputations to uphold. Typical pricing for a standard quarterly preventative program for a residential home can range from $100-$150 per treatment, while one-time services for specific issues like rodent or wildlife removal often start at $250-$500, depending on the severity and scope of the problem.

Frequently Asked Questions About Pest Control in Saint Cloud

Get answers to common questions about pest control services in Saint Cloud, Wisconsin.

1What are the most common pest problems for homeowners in Saint Cloud, WI, and when should I be most vigilant?

In Saint Cloud and surrounding Fond du Lac County, the most prevalent pests include mice and voles seeking winter shelter, ants (especially carpenter and pavement ants) in spring/summer, and mosquitoes due to our proximity to wetlands and the Fond du Lac River. Be most vigilant in late summer and fall for rodents, spring for ants, and throughout the warm months for mosquitoes and wasps, as our distinct four-season climate drives pests indoors as temperatures drop.

2How much should I expect to pay for professional pest control services in the Saint Cloud area?

Costs vary based on the pest and property size. For a standard one-time interior/exterior treatment for ants or spiders, expect $125-$250. Seasonal mosquito or tick services typically range from $50-$80 per treatment. Rodent exclusion and control can be $250-$500+. Many local providers offer annual maintenance plans ($400-$700/year) which are cost-effective for year-round protection against Wisconsin's seasonal pest cycles.

3Are there any local Wisconsin or Fond du Lac County regulations I should know about regarding pest control on my property?

Yes. All commercial pest control companies in Wisconsin must be licensed by the Department of Agriculture, Trade and Consumer Protection (DATCP). For specific pests like mosquitoes, Saint Cloud residents should coordinate with the Fond du Lac County Public Health Department, which may have abatement programs. Special care is required near waterways due to regulations protecting the Fox River watershed from pesticide runoff.

4What should I look for when choosing a pest control provider serving Saint Cloud?

First, verify their Wisconsin DATCP license and insurance. Choose a company with extensive local experience, as they will understand regional pest behavior and seasonal patterns. Ask about their specific strategies for common local issues like field mice or carpenter ants. Finally, seek providers who offer integrated pest management (IPM) approaches, focusing on exclusion and prevention, which is crucial for long-term control in our climate.

5I've heard about "cluster flies" and "boxelder bugs" being a major nuisance in Wisconsin. When do these appear in Saint Cloud and how are they managed?

These are significant seasonal nuisances here. Cluster flies seek attic and wall voids for overwintering in late summer/fall, while boxelder bugs congregate on sunny house sides in fall. Management involves proactive exterior sealing in late summer, targeted insecticide barriers applied by professionals before peak activity, and possibly vacuum removal for indoor invaders. Proper management is essential as our cold winters drive these pests to seek shelter in structures.
